Output 1724f7d20f5354f198554465c03f77df5bcc81e251fff7d653ee45d39183e588:21

value
40893330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e415a33c189522e19bd0ae68c38f924a6df45bce OP_EQUAL
address
3NV1ugzgaMrkWjGMTCSfB5R4NKs3fmBARh
transaction
1724f7d20f5354f198554465c03f77df5bcc81e251fff7d653ee45d39183e588
spent
true